Mirror to a Mac Mini

Right now I SuperDuper my MacBook Pro to a USB disk drive. Full bootable image.

I'm thinking about buying a new gen mini. Can I mirror my MBP to the mini periodically to use it as a full running hot back up?

Unlikely: I'm guessing the new mini will have a special OS build, and won't boot from what you have on the MBP until the OS has "synced up".

For what its worth, I had a Mac Mini (Core Duo from a couple years ago) running 10.5.6, backed it up to a USB hard drive, installed a new blank 320gb 7200RPM drive in a new Mac Mini (2009) booted the new Mini to the USB drive, and restored my OS.

The new Minis ship with a 10.5.6 DVD. Just remember to use the Applications disc to upgrade the iLife on your new Mini!
